Content and structure of the minor
About the minor
Building technology plays a central role in creating safe and sustainable living spaces. The Building Technology Minor offers students good overall knowledge within the field of civil and structural engineering.
The completion of the Minor in Building Technology, will provide the student basic knowledge of selected aspects related to the design, construction, use, and maintenance of civil engineering structures.

Content and structure of the minor
The Building Technology Minor offers students good overall knowledge within the field of civil and structural engineering. The programme involves education in structural engineering, building physics, construction management and building materials.
Upon completion of the Minor in Building Technology, the student will comprehend the fundamental physical phenomena in structural and thermal performance of buildings, and use the engineering methods for their assessment. He or she can also describe and use the management methods for construction processes.
